Building vs buying software
Building vs buying is always a fraught decision. Nominally buying a solution provides more capability and a quicker time to market, but then you have the potential of vendor lock in and being constrained by the limitations of the tool that you chose. And in the engineering world, it’s even harder. While Not Invented Here syndrome is becoming less prevalent, you still need to pick between a ground up implementation or leveraging open source, professional open source and commercial offerings. And then to think about how to incorporate low code APIs and no code solutions into your tech mix in a way that reduces build and maintenance costs without limiting the quality of your final solution. Join us to hear how James thinks about this balance - both as a CEO of a company that buys other peoples software and as the founder of a company that sells its own SaaS solution.
Special thanks to our global partner – Amazon Web Services (AWS). AWS offers a broad set of global cloud-based products to equip technology leaders to build better and more powerful solutions, reach out to firstname.lastname@example.org if you’re interested to learn more about their offerings.
And thanks to our sustaining partners:
CodeClimate - Engineering leaders who are motivated to exceed 2021 goals know that gut-feel isn't enough to make performance-improving decisions. CTOs, VPEs and Directors at organizations like Slack, Gusto, Pizza Hut trust objective data from Code Climate Velocity to measure and improve productivity, efficiency and performance. Reach out to Code Climate and get a month free when you mention CTO Connection.
Karat - Karat helps companies hire software engineers by designing and conducting technical interview programs that improve hiring signal, mitigate bias, and reduce the interviewing time burden on engineering teams. Check out this short video or visit Karat.com to learn how we can help you grow your team.
LaunchDarkly - the Feature Management Platform Powering the Best Software Products
Our vision is to eliminate risk for developers and operations teams from the software development cycle. As companies transition to a world built on software, there is an increasing requirement to move quickly—but that often comes with the desire to maintain control. LaunchDarkly is the feature management platform that enables dev and ops teams to control the whole feature lifecycle, from concept to launch to value. Learn more at https://launchdarkly.com/
CTO Connection is a community where senior engineering leaders can connect with and learn from their peers!
If you'd like to receive new episodes as they're published, please subscribe to CTO Connection in Apple Podcasts, Google Podcasts, Spotify or wherever you get your podcasts. If you enjoyed this episode, please consider leaving a review in Apple Podcasts. It really helps others find the